18 Replacing the solid-state drive/Intel Optane Enable the Intel Optane after you replace it. For more information about enabling the Intel Optane, see Enabling Intel Optane. WARNING: Before working inside your computer, read the safety information that shipped with your computer and follow the steps in Before working inside your computer. After working inside your computer, follow the instructions in After working inside your computer. For more safety best practices, see the Regulatory Compliance home page at www.dell.com/ regulatory_compliance. CAUTION: Solid-state drives are fragile. Exercise care when handling the solid-state drive. Procedure 1 Align the notch on the solid-state drive/Intel Optane with the tab on the slot and slide the solid-state drive/Intel Optane into the slot. NOTE: Solid-state drive shield is available only on computers shipped with NVMe solid-state drive. 2 Slide the solid-state drive shield/Intel Optane shield into the tabs and replace the solid-state drive shield/Intel Optane shield on the palm rest and keyboard assembly. 3 Replace the screw (M2x3) that secures the solid-state drive/Intel Optane to the palm rest and keyboard assembly. 4 Tighten the captive screw that secures the solid-state drive shield/Intel Optane shield and solid-state drive/Intel Optane to the palm rest and keyboard assembly. Post-requisites Replace the base cover. Replacing the solid-state drive/Intel Optane 35
